PayPaL, what's new?


I have two Paypal accounts. My old one, I am using it to purchase things online. The other account is to collect payments from the services I rendered online. I use separate accounts because I just want to separate my business/ work transaction. I think there is nothing wrong with that until recently. Well, I have no problems using Paypal. Their service is good and the fee to transfer the money on your bank or credit/debit card account is reasonable.

But here's now the story. Just last night, when I received payments from my client. I noticed that Paypal charged a fee from the money I received from my pay out. What is more disappointing is, I can not withdraw the money and transfer it to my other account if I will not add and verify my credit card. The inconvenience is, I can not use my existing credit card and bank account since I am using it in my old paypal account.

It was really giving me a headache. So I need to ask favor from my client who made the payment. I had to refund the payment and he has to resend it to my old account. I was also sending an email brigade to all my clients telling them I am now changing my Paypal account along with the lengthy explanation. Phew! Whatta pain that caused me and my clients.
